How to Make the Perfect Homemade Chickpea Crackers
Ingredients
- 1 cup chickpea flour: The star ingredient, providing a nutty flavor and a gluten-free base.
- 1/2 teaspoon salt: Enhances the overall flavor of the crackers.
- 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der: Adds a savory depth that elevates the taste.
- 1/2 teaspoon onion powder: Complements the garlic and brings a subtle sweetness.
- 1/4 teaspoon black pepper: Introduces a mild heat and complexity.
- 1/4 cup water: Binds the ingredients together to form a dough.
- 2 tablespoons olive oil: Contributes richness and helps achieve a crispy texture.
Feel free to experiment with optional ingredients like herbs (such as rosemary or thyme) or spices (like paprika or cumin) to create unique flavor profiles!
Step-by-Step Instructions
- Preheat the oven: Set your oven to 350°F (175°C) to prepare for baking.
- Mix dry ingredients: In a mixing bowl, combine the chickpea flour, salt, garlic powder, onion powder, and black pepper. The aroma of the spices will start to fill your kitchen!
- Add wet ingredients: Pour in the water and olive oil. Mix until a dough forms. It should be slightly sticky but manageable.
- Roll out the dough: Place the dough between two sheets of parchment paper. Roll it out until it’s thin, about 1/8 inch thick. This ensures a crispy cracker!
- Cut into shapes: Use a knife or pizza cutter to slice the dough into your desired shapes. Squares or triangles work well!
- Bake: Transfer the cut crackers to a baking sheet and bake for 20-25 minutes, or until they are golden and crispy. Keep an eye on them to avoid burning!
- Cool: Let the crackers cool on a wire rack before serving. This step is crucial for achieving that perfect crunch!

Storing and Reheating Tips
To keep your Homemade Chickpea Crackers fresh and crunchy, follow these simple storage and reheating tips:
- Room Temperature: Store the crackers in an airtight container at room temperature for up to a week. This helps maintain their crispiness.
- Refrigeration: If you live in a humid climate, consider refrigerating the crackers. Just ensure they are in a sealed container to prevent moisture absorption.
- Freezing: For longer storage, freeze the crackers in a single layer on a baking sheet. Once frozen, transfer them to a freezer-safe bag or container. They can last up to three months.
- Reheating: To restore crispiness, reheat the crackers in a preheated oven at 350°F (175°C) for about 5-7 minutes. This will bring back their delightful crunch!
Common Mistakes to Avoid
- Not Measuring Ingredients Accurately: Precision is key in baking. Using too much or too little chickpea flour can affect the texture of your crackers.
- Skipping the Cooling Step: Allowing your crackers to cool completely is crucial for achieving that perfect crunch. If you skip this, they may end up chewy instead of crispy.
- Baking at the Wrong Temperature: Ensure your oven is preheated to 350°F (175°C). Baking at a lower temperature can result in soggy crackers.
- Overcrowding the Baking Sheet: Give your crackers space on the baking sheet. Overcrowding can lead to uneven baking and less crispiness.

PrintHomemade Chickpea Crackers: A Healthy and Easy Snack Recipe to Try!
A healthy and easy snack recipe made from chickpeas.
- Prep Time: 10 minutes
- Cook Time: 25 minutes
- Total Time: 35 minutes
- Yield: 4 servings 1x
- Category: Snack
- Method: Baking
- Cuisine: Mediterranean
- Diet: Vegan
Ingredients
- 1 cup chickpea flour
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1/2 teaspoon onion powder
- 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
- 1/4 cup water
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C).
- In a mixing bowl, combine chickpea flour, salt, garlic powder, onion powder, and black pepper.
- Add water and olive oil to the dry ingredients and mix until a dough forms.
- Roll out the dough between two sheets of parchment paper until thin.
- Cut into desired shapes and place on a baking sheet.
- Bake for 20-25 minutes or until golden and crispy.
- Let cool before serving.
Notes
- Store in an airtight container for up to a week.
- Experiment with different spices for varied flavors.
